Beloved

 

Beloved, stand fast against the corrosion of time.
Hold tight to the acute sense of love,
And be not jaded by the ignorance of life.
For, as in most worlds, to live in this now is a trial by fire.

Also, forget not that there is a hand held out,
Ready for the taking and begging to be held.
Envelop that hand with the ferocity of ages,
And hold tight for the worth of thy soul.

And lastly, turn a fond eye into thy own soul.
A lifetime's worth of malice passes, at times in a single glance,
So let not thyself be the messenger of that anger,
But rather carry the talisman of self worth in thy breast.
